The difference professional grading makes is often a key consideration for homeowners planning outdoor projects or property improvements. When people search for this topic, they usually want to understand how professional grading can impact the stability, drainage, and overall appearance of their property. Proper grading involves shaping the land to ensure water flows away from structures and prevents issues like flooding or foundation problems. Homeowners may be exploring options for preparing a yard for new construction, leveling uneven terrain, or improving the landscape’s drainage system. They are interested in how skilled grading can provide a solid foundation for their projects and avoid costly repairs down the line.

This topic is closely related to problems such as poor water runoff, soil erosion, or uneven land that can hinder landscaping plans or new construction. Many homeowners have plans to build patios, install driveways, or create gardens, but face challenges with existing terrain that doesn’t drain well or is prone to shifting. Proper grading by experienced service providers can address these issues by shaping the land to promote proper water flow and soil stability. Whether it’s a backyard renovation or preparing a property for a new structure, understanding the benefits of professional grading helps homeowners make informed decisions about how to approach their projects.

When evaluating service providers for grading projects, it’s important to consider their experience with similar types of work. A contractor who has successfully handled projects comparable in scope and complexity can often bring valuable insights and practical knowledge that contribute to a more effective outcome. Asking about their past work or reviewing examples of completed projects can help gauge their familiarity with the specific requirements of grading, ensuring that the chosen professional understands the nuances involved in achieving the desired results.

Clear, written expectations are essential when comparing local contractors for grading services. A reputable service provider should be able to provide a detailed outline of the work scope, materials, and methods involved. This documentation hel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ures everyone is aligned on what will be delivered. When reviewing proposals or estimates, look for clarity and thoroughness, as well as any guarantees or warranties that might be included. Well-defined expectations support a smoother process and contribute to the overall success of the project.

Reputable references and effective communication are key factors in choosing the right contractor for grading work. Service providers with a history of satisfied clients can offer insights into their reliability, professionalism, and quality of work. Contacting references allows homeowners to learn about the contractor’s ability to meet deadlines, stay within scope, and address concerns promptly. Additionally, good communication throughout the project-whether through timely responses or clear updates-helps ensure that expectations are managed and issues are resolved quickly, ultimately making a significant difference in the outcome of the grading project.
